After a couple years of caching, we've collected a strange assortment of geo-swag. Now is the time to thin out the collection.

Your looking for a 6 inch tall by 4 inch square container with a 3 inch round opening. This container sports the latest in jungle camo duct tape. The original contents are:

* Koosh Balls
* Wrist Compass
* Swag Bag
* Geocaching Page
* Log Book & Pen

Parking can be found at East Bluff Park. The 1st ¼ mile is a concrete walkway. Leave the loop to find the easy way in.
